Question: When treated with ammoniacal cuprous chloride, which one among the following forms copper derivative [CBSE PMT 1989; MP PMT 1993]
Options:
A) $ C_2H_6 $
B) $ C_2H_4 $
C) $ C_2H_2 $
D) $ C_6H_6 $
Show Answer
Answer:
Correct Answer: C
Solution:
$ 2NH_4OH+Cu_2Cl_2\to 2CuOH+2NH_4Cl $
$ NH_4OH+CuOH\to \underset{\begin{smallmatrix} \text{Diammine copper} \\ ( I )\text{ hydroxide} \end{smallmatrix}}{\mathop{[Cu{{(NH_3)}_2}]OH}} $
$ 2[Cu{{(NH_3)}_2}]OH+HC\equiv CH\to $
$ \underset{\text{copper acetylide Red ppt}\text{.}}{\mathop{Cu-C\equiv C-Cu}}+4NH_3+2H_2O $
